A new addition to the timeshare exit and claims industry has emerged in the shape of Meredith Pritchard. This company has popped up on to the radar with little less than whisper and is an emerging talking point within the industries channels. In a field that is so caught up in lies, scams and broken promises, one expects the announcement of this new option will already have many desperate timeshare owners wondering if this company may be more successful than any of the other’s offering the same range of services.

With the domain name of meredithpritchard.com being registered in early October by a Mr Stephen Fairclough stating an office address of: Regus House, Herons Way, Chester, CH4 9QR – This address actually turns out to be a Regus rental unit as apposed to an actual company head office, this is just the first alarm bell that begin’s to ring in one’s head.

With the connection between Meredith Pritchard and the Mr Fairclough being unknown, this led to further investigation to uncover the affiliation between the two.

As documented by Company House in late September a second company was discovered in the name of Meredith Pritchard Claims Consultants Ltd with a VAT registration number of 10395171, this company is registered to an alternate address of: Unit 8-9 Parsons Court, Welbury Way, Aycliffe Buisness Park, Newton Aycliffe, Co Durham, England, DL5 6ZE. On the applications it details the company Director’s name as Mr Stephen Paul Fairclough, and the connection starts to fall into place.

Moving on to the website which provides the consumer with no exact or in depth information on how or what Meredith Pritchard, actually do to exit you from your timeshare successfully. This is a worry that the information visible at this time is merely a generic overview on timeshare legislation and contact details showing an email address of: info@meredithpritchard.com with a Chester area telephone number of 01244 893100.

With the slogan on the home page of the website claiming to provide “Experience you can Trust” if this is the case then where exactly have they been gaining this experience as this is the first inkling of this company’s creation up until now? Revealing that they use a team of international lawyers to fight these timeshare giants on you behalf, along with suggesting they have a proven procedure to stop future maintenance fee’s, as well as a secure cancellation policy.

Further into their website in the example sentences area, they claim that they have already succeeded in securing high court and supreme court rulings against the likes of Silverpoint and Anfi, this being quite good going for a company which was only registered two month ago. In fact the documents that show on their website are all dated prior to the company even being registered.

These are very big promises for such a fledgling business, will Meredith Pritchard follow suit with the rest or will they be the new voice of the consumers, we will all have to wait and see.

One hopes for the best in a industry that has such a disgraceful reputation of promising the world and actually providing anything more than a head ache to go with the pain of an empty wallet.
